Description of Work
The Classification and Compensation Consultant serves as a subject-matter expert and strategic partner responsible for the comprehensive administration, analysis, and implementation of classification and compensation practices for SHRA, EPS/ EHRA, and faculty positions at Elizabeth City State University. This role collaborates closely with University leadership and management to ensure position structures, job descriptions, compensation decisions (i.e. salary adjustments, supplemental pay, etc.), and FLSA designations are accurate, equitable, compliant, and aligned with UNC System regulations, institutional priorities, and labor market conditions.
The consultant leads and supports classification reviews, desk audits, position evaluations, and organizational analyses; provides authoritative guidance on compensation and exemption status determinations; and ensures consistent application of policies that promote internal equity, fiscal responsibility, and workforce effectiveness. Through data-driven analysis and consultative support, the role advances the University's goals of attracting, retaining, and developing a high-performing workforce while maintaining compliance with applicable laws, regulations, and system-wide standards.
This position is organizationally aligned to report to the Interim Chief Human Resources Officer.
